Maintenance Menu
You can set printing conditions such as density and calibration, and printer
management such as formatting the optional hard disk unit.

HD Format
Follow the procedure below to set HD Format.
A
Press the {Menu} key.
The [Menu] screen appears.
B
Press the {T} or {U} key to display [Maintenance], and then press the {q En-
ter} key.
C
Press the {T} or {U} key to display [HD Format], and then press the {q Enter}
key.
D
Read the HD format confirmation message, and then press the {q Enter}
key.
The hard disk unit is formatted, and the message appears.
E
Press the {q Enter} key.
The [HD Format] screen appears.
F
Press the {On Line} key.
The initial screen appears.
Note
❒ The [HD Format] menu appears only when the optional hard disk is in-
stalled.
Reference
For details about the optional hard disk unit, see Hardware Guide.
